Today, we gather to celebrate the remarkable, kind, and loving life of Charlotte Marie (Finnell) Penebaker.

Born and raised in Cincinnati, Ohio, Charlotte lived a life full of love, warmth, and dedication. She spent seven years working at Revlon Consumer Products LLC before building a decades-long career at Cincinnati Bell, where her infectious kindness and unwavering work ethic made her beloved by colleagues and friends alike.

In her free time, Charlotte enjoyed life's many joys—listening to music, attending concerts, watching movies, and cheering for her favorite sports teams. She was a loyal fan of the Cincinnati Bengals and an avid admirer of Kobe Bryant and the Los Angeles Lakers. Above all, Charlotte found her greatest happiness in the company of her family, particularly her grandchildren and great-grandchildren, who were the light of her life.
